Transaction 7c76f254a0641ae98ba5840461d23bce93c8d506b2a9c0796790c5ca43976b54

2 Input
2 Outputs
  • 7c76f254a0641ae98ba5840461d23bce93c8d506b2a9c0796790c5ca43976b54:0
  • value  12315569
    address  3R1jNHabVPJhBPW1tEFpcFTcvhUFGkJUWJ
  • 7c76f254a0641ae98ba5840461d23bce93c8d506b2a9c0796790c5ca43976b54:1
  • value  1000094
    address  3KNqeucztmeMoRW7YyhDYNq3TTHuZwL6Yo